SOUTH EAST NORTHUMBERLAND FRIENDSHIP CENTRE
Seniors
E Farm Terrace, Cramlington NE23 1DT, UK
Marian Gourley, Membership Secretary 07484241452Marian Gourley, Membership Secretary 07484241452
0748424145207484241452

An opportunity for over-50s to meet in a relaxed and friendly environment and make new friends. Monthly meetings include a speaker or light entertainment and raffle and the opportunity to mingle with other members and develop new friendships. We hold a pub lunch each month, at different pub/ restaurant venues in the area.

Normally meet the first Wednesday of each month, 1.30pm – 3.30pm.

£10 pa membership fee, £2 per meeting to include speaker or light entertainment and a raffle.

You are welcome to just turn up to one of our meetings, first two visits are free, then if you like us become a member.

Cramlington Camera Club
Health and Leisure
doxford methodist church 0.67 km
http://www.cramcams.org.uk/

Cramlington Camera Club puts on a programme of events during weekly meetings from the beginning of September until the beginning of May.  These include guest speakers, competitions for prints (colour and monochrome) and for PDIs (Projected Digital Images), presentations from club members, and opportunities to take photographs and learn about your camera.

There is an annual subscription fee of £28.00 and an entrance fee of £1.00.  The subscription fee reduces to £14.00 after 1 January, to reflect the fact that only half a season remains.

Presently, meetings are held in Doxford Methodist Church, starting at 19:30 and usually end at about 21:00.  Tea and Coffee is served during the half hour before each meeting.

Jane Percy House
Health and Leisure
Brockwell Centre, Northumbrian Road, Cramlington NE23 1XX, UK 1.12 km
0167059033301670590333

Jane Percy House supports people with a range of disabilities including cerebral palsy, muscular dystrophy, spina bifida and arthritis, multiple sclerosis and disabilities resulting from accidents or a stroke. As well as providing physical care, it is committed to ensuring that people have control over their lives and are treated with dignity and respect at all times.

Located in Cramlington, Northumberland, they provide accommodation and support for people with complex and high dependency needs, giving independence and lifestyle choices for adults with physical disabilities. It forms part of the nationwide network of disability support services provided by The Disabilities Trust.
